Output 905042dd27144ddd018e08ee4cd3798e6a8de1add0fe0d1249bc6d598b5b24bf:1

value
32873583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f6124f94ea314890811434067e8bf0021c84374 OP_EQUAL
address
MGbUoNFzsQknoV5f79s5FXinX6QNhEavJg
transaction
905042dd27144ddd018e08ee4cd3798e6a8de1add0fe0d1249bc6d598b5b24bf
spent
true